Identify the legal basis for requiring investigative reports

Ans: PC, section 11107 requires each sheriff or police
chief executive to furnish reports specified misdemeanors
and felonies to the DOJ department of justice



Report must have

Ans: Describe the nature and character of each crime,
includes supporting evidence collected, note all
particular circumstances, include all additional and
supplemental information pertaining to the suspected
criminal activity



Why should the ability to write reports be personally
important to you as a correctional peace officer?

Ans: Moral obligation, stand up to legal scrutiny, and the
right thing to do

Why are departmental reports important for the legal
process in court system, both criminal and civilly?

Ans: legal process relies on departmental reports as the
main account of the event or incident



Identify the three-step process for taking notes during a
full interview

Ans: Listen attentively, take notes and ask questions,
verify information



Identify the primary questions that must be answered
within an effective report

Ans: Who, what, when, where, how, why (if possible)



Initial information

Ans: Describe the officer's immediate observations of any
action taken upon arrival at the scene



identification of the crime

Ans: the facts, or the evidence of a crime, referred to as
the corpus delicti it, or the body of the crime



Identification of involved parties

Ans: Can include the person(s) who reported the
incident, victim(s), witness(es), or suspect(s)



Witness/victim statements:

Ans: helps place events in their proper sequence,
establish the elements of the crime



Crime scene specifics

Ans: Physical condition of the scene it's self, chronology
of events, location of physical evidence



Property information:

Ans: Such as brand names, model/serial numbers,
description like color, unique markings and dimensions,
value of stolen item, Location where the item was found
or stolen and relationship of the item to the crime/incident

CDCR correctional officer actions

Ans: Complete report should clearly identify all actions
taken by an officer, actions can include Searches
conducted, seizures of evidence, arrests, standard
procedures such as knock and notice, field show up,
Miranda admonishments, use of force, medical attention,
safety measures taken, disposition of suspect, methods
used to preserve evidence or capture essential
information



CDCR memorandum

Ans: Written for a variety of reasons, including lost staff
identification card, observed misconduct by staff or
reports of inspection



Counseling only RVR

Ans: used to document an inmates minor misconduct
